Hyatt has an employee rating of 3.9 out of 5 stars, based on 6,961 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Hyatt employ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Turismo y hospedaje industry (3.6 stars).

Pros

Good location, major hospitality brand

Cons

I felt like there was little room for internal advancement. Managers don't develop their current employees and often decide to hire externally which is very demoralizing. Most of my department left after being told they were not qualified enough despite meeting all the requirements. Managers and above are in cliques. On the off chance an internal hire is selected for a role, this has already been decided among the "clique" before the job listing is posted. How can there be a healthy culture if directors are badmouthing the very people they work with? There is a nonexistent work-life balance. We were expected to work July 4th, Memorial Day, and Labor day. WHY? Raises here are abyssal and do not keep up with yearly inflation. I hope that eventually they catch on a realize people keep declining offers because their offers are weak. Brace yourself for 2.5% raises on a "good" year. Hyatt does NOT care for people so they can be their best, despite that being the motto. I would possibly recommend other areas of Hyatt, but stay away from Accounting/finance.
